How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Dellrose?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Dellrose Studio Apartments | $1,011 | $899 | $1,081 |
Dellrose 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,207 | $850 | $1,955 |
Dellrose 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,519 | $940 | $2,165 |
Dellrose 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,079 | $1,149 | $2,395 |
Dellrose 4 Bedroom Apartments | $2,466 | $2,326 | $2,645 |

Frequently Asked Questions about New Dellrose Apartments
What is the Cheapest New apartment in Dellrose?
Currently the most affordable New Apartment in Dellrose is at 1010 Elliston listed at $899.
How much is the average rent for a New Dellrose Apartment?
The average rent for a New Apartment in Dellrose is $1,654.
What is the largest New Dellrose Apartment for rent?
Today's New apartment with the most square footage in Dellrose is a 1,996 square feet unit starting from $1,899 at Lakeside Residences.
What is the average size for Dellrose New Apartments for rent?
The average size for a New rental in Dellrose is currently at 913 sq ft.
